Southaven- Come and try our Infused Vodka!



Come and try our Flavor Infusions today!
Strawberry, Vanilla, Bell Pepper, Pineapple, Honeydew-Cantaloupe, Cherry and we will have Peach very soon!
Infusing your own Vodka is easy. Just fill a container with fruit and top with your favorite Vodka. Be sure to keep the fruit covered with the Vodka to prevent spoiling. When your Vodka has enough flavor, you can take the fruit out and pour the Vodka back into its original bottle. If you keep it refrigerated, it will last longer. Certain fruits like strawberry, orange and peach need a little simple syrup added to the mixture to bring out their natural flavor.
______________________________________________
Strawberry Limeade
1 ½ ounces Strawberry Infused Vodka
½ ounce fresh squeezed Lime Juice
Fill glass with Lemon Lime Soda
